The Kwara State Police Command has said the charred bodies of the 12 victims of the fatal accident which happened along the Ilorin/Ogbomoso road on Saturday will undergo mass burial.
The Police Public Relations Officer, Ajayi Okasanmi, in a statement, said the development followed the request by the victims’ families and public health officials.
